About agriculture in Bledos

Bledos is located in the southwestern part of the state of San Luis Potosí, Mexico, within the municipality of Villa de Arriaga. The landscape is characterized by the high plateau of the Potosí Altiplano, featuring semi-arid plains surrounded by rugged hills and mountains. The surrounding rural area is dotted with historic haciendas and vast stretches of scrubland typical of central Mexico's high-altitude desert environment.

The agricultural sector in this region revolves around a mix of traditional dryland farming and livestock production. Key crops include maize, beans, and forage for cattle. The area is also known for its history of large-scale ranching, where cattle and sheep are raised on extensive pastures. In some parts of the municipality, there is growing interest in protected agriculture and the cultivation of agave, which is well-suited to the local climate.

For agronomists and seasonal workers, Bledos offers opportunities primarily in livestock management and the maintenance of traditional field crops. Labor demand peaks during the sowing and harvesting seasons of maize and beans, as well as during cattle processing periods. Workers should expect a rural, high-altitude environment with a dry climate, where expertise in water management and sustainable grazing practices is highly valued.
